AI-illustration af IT Desk Guy

At migrere fra én platform til en anden kan være en udfordrende opgave, der ofte kræver betydelige ressourcer og tid. Dog gør de nyeste værktøjer og AI-fremskridt det muligt at forenkle denne proces.

7.2.25

AF SARAH JAINVI

I dette blogindlæg vil vi undersøge, hvordan vi med succes migrerede vores website fra Sitecore XP og .NET MVC til Sitecore XM Cloud – uden at behovet for at kode.

Hvorfor er migrering udfordrende?

Migrering indebærer overførsel af data, konfigurationer og funktioner fra ét system til et andet. Denne proces kan være kompleks på grund af forskelle i platformarkitektur, dataformater og integrationskrav. Vores mål var at finde ud af, om vi kunne strømline denne proces ved hjælp af out-of-the-box (OOTB) værktøjer og Sitecores page builder.

Vores tilgang

Vi brugte vores nuværende websites forside som eksempel til at demonstrere migreringsprocessen. Her er en trin-for-trin gennemgang af, hvordan vi gjorde:

1. Opsætning af XM Cloud
Det første skridt var at opsætte XM Cloud. Vi fulgte den officielle dokumentation for at implementere et projekt og en miljøopsætning. Dette gav os grundlaget for vores migrering. Den officielle dokumentation kan findes her

2. Grundlæggende opsætning – Frontend styles
Vi etablerede de grundlæggende frontend styles, herunder:

 

  • Basics: Fonts, farver og breakpoints.
  • Regler: Typografi, dekorationer (borders, skygger), fill colors, og spacing.
  • Inline Elements: Tekst, knapper, links, og badges.
  • Block Elements: Sections, cards, block quotes, og image blocks.

 

Frontend Styles

 

3. Identificering af komponenter
Derefter gennemgik vi vores style guide og design for at identificere genanvendelige og ikke-genanvendelige komponenter:

 

  • Genanvendelige komponenter: Cards, buttons, links, sections og spacing.
  • Ikke-genanvendelige komponenter: Forside hero, CTA'er, og indholdsblokke.

 

Components

 

4. Oprettelse af komponenter
Vi oprettede komponentvarianter til forskellige skærmstørrelser

 

  • Desktop
  • Tablet
  • Mobil


Device previews

 


5. Opbygning af siden

Ved hjælp af drag-and-drop component builder samlede vi siden. Værktøjet gør det muligt nemt at kunne placere og konfigurere komponenter uden at skrive nogen kode.

 

 

Front page build



6. Preview vs. Live Site

Til sidst sammenlignede vi preview af siden med den live version for at sikre, at alt fungerede korrekt. Dette trin var afgørende for at verificere, at migreringen var vellykket, og at hjemmesiden både visuelt og funktionelt levede op til forventningerne.

På billedet nedenfor kan du se resultatet: XM Cloud (venstre) vs. Live-site (højre).



XM Cloud vs Live site

 

Værktøjer og ressourcer

Gennem migreringsprocessen brugte vi forskellige værktøjer og ressourcer, herunder:

  • XM Cloud Live Homepage Content Migration Tools
  • XM Cloud FAQ
  • Sitecore Developer Portal
  • XM Cloud Tools and Resources


Konklusion

Vores no-code tilgang til at migrere til Sitecore XM Cloud viste sig at være både effektiv og tidsbesparende. Ved at udnytte OOTB-værktøjer og Sitecores page builder kunne vi forenkle migrationsprocessen og nå vores mål – uden at skrive en eneste linje kode. Denne metode kan fungere som en værdifuld reference for andre, der ønsker at gennemføre en lignende migration.